From the 15th century onwards, Christian clergy launched a persecution of witches for nearly 300 years based on the Bible's "saying" that "a woman who practices sorcerers shall not allow her to live." During these 300 years of darkness, countless women of good families were falsely accused of being "witches", or beheaded in public, or burned at the stake. In 1487, the Church published the Witch's Hammer, a "specialized book" for witch hunting. With the spread of modern printing technology invented by Gutenberg in Europe, the book was reprinted nearly 30 times in the nearly 200 years from 1487 to 1669, thus triggering a protracted "witch hunt". The Hammer of the Witches details the specific methods of interrogation of "witches" and the effective methods used to ensure the success of the trial. There is neither a prosecution process nor a defender, and in addition to torture as a means of extracting confessions, there is also the so-called "witch" test.

According to the theory provided in the book, since the "witches" were enchanted by the devil and were no longer sensitive to pain, they could be tortured as they pleased. For example, if the defendant's hand is burned with a red-hot iron block, if the hand is burned, the defendant is guilty; Have the defendant take a holy ring with his hand in boiling water, then put a bandage and seal on his hand, and after 3 days if there is no trace, he will be innocent, and so on......

An even more bizarre way to identify the defendant is to tie the defendant's hands and feet and throw her into the lake -- if she sinks to the bottom, she is not guilty; Conversely, if she floats on the water, it means that she is blessed by the devil and must be burned at the stake. The result of this absurdity is that regardless of whether the person being judged is "guilty" or not, they have no choice but to die.
